Is Gwen Stefani’s New Single About Blake Shelton?

Gwen Stefani just released her new, self-penned single, “Make Me Like You,” and the internet is a-buzz with claims that the song is about her boyfriend, Blake Shelton

Stefani and Shelton bonded over the summer after Stefani split with Gavin Rossdale and Shelton’s four-year marriage to Miranda Lambert came to an end. Although they were quite flirty on the last season of The Voice, the pair did not confirm their relationship until early November when Gwen flew to Nashville to accompany Blake to a CMA Awards after-party. Since then, they’ve been seemingly inseparable. 

Stefani appears to be opening up about falling for Shelton in the song.

Upon the song’s release to iTunes, Shelton took to Twitter to share his thoughts writing, “You can probably understand the multiple reasons why I just bought this… I hope you do to!!!” He also included a link to purchase the track.
